Qwest Wireless To Shut Down October 31BARRONS.com: Tech Trader Daily
Qwest (Q) advised customers today that it will discontinue its Qwest Wireless service on October 31. The company last year announced plans to exit the wireless business , and instead to re-sell service from Verizon Wireless ( VZ , VOD ). ...
